As a member of our team, you will have the opportunity to work in a dynamic and collaborative environment, where your ideas and contributions will be valued and respected.
To assemble components using a variety of fixtures, gauges, tools, and equipment.
Role and Responsibilities
- Produce a quality product in a timely manner individually or as part of a team.
- Read, understand, and follow Work Instructions, Manufacturing Procedures and Job Instruction Sheets.
- Visually inspect components and finished product during the assembly process to ensure acceptable product is produced
- Complete all required daily documentation whether manual or electronically
- Keep work area clean and organized
- Place scrap components in appropriate red scrap bins
- Notify Supervisor/Manager of any recurring defects identified
- Verify all labeling for legibility and accuracy to lot number
- Adhere to all Atrion policies including safety, attendance, and personal hygiene requirements per the Atrion Employee Handbook.
